Pipitor
A Twitter bot that gathers Tweets from a specified set of accounts, filters and Retweets them.
Features
- Pipitor uses the
POST statuses/filterAPI. It can get the Tweets in realtime without worrying being rate limited. - Pipitor optionally supports getting past Tweets from a list, so it can even retrieve Tweets posted while it was suspended.
Usage
Download the latest binary package for your platform from the releases page and install it to a directory of your choice.
Or alternatively, you can manually build the project from the source (requires Nightly Rust):
cargo install pipitor
After the installation, create a manifest file named Pipitor.toml in the working directory.
Manifest format is shown in Pipitor.example.toml.
Then, run the following, and follow the instructions on the command line:
pipitor setup
Now, you're all set! Run the following to start the bot:
pipitor run
